Chelsea have made a late move for Real Madrid defender Raphael Varane.
Marca says the news will come as a bitter blow for United who have been edging closer to a £50million deal for the Frenchman.
The West Londoners have emerged as late contenders and could scupper the transfer.
If they can fend off the reported interest from the Blues, United look set to hand over a £50m fee for the centre-back who has just one year left on his Bernabeu contract.
Spanish giants Real initially wanted £60m for Varane but have to sell now to get a fee having lost Sergio Ramos to Paris Saint-Germain on a free. (Tribal Football)
